diff options
| author | Ethan Morgan <ethan@gweithio.com> | 2026-02-14 16:44:06 +0000 |
|---|---|---|
| committer | Ethan Morgan <ethan@gweithio.com> | 2026-02-14 16:44:06 +0000 |
| commit | 54409423f767d8b1cf30cb7d0efca6b4ca138823 (patch) | |
| tree | d915ac7828703ce4b963efdd9728a1777ba18c1e /vcpkg/ports/ggml/vcpkg.json | |
Diffstat (limited to 'vcpkg/ports/ggml/vcpkg.json')
| -rw-r--r-- | vcpkg/ports/ggml/vcpkg.json | 68 |
1 files changed, 68 insertions, 0 deletions
diff --git a/vcpkg/ports/ggml/vcpkg.json b/vcpkg/ports/ggml/vcpkg.json new file mode 100644 index 0000000..8ee70b4 --- /dev/null +++ b/vcpkg/ports/ggml/vcpkg.json @@ -0,0 +1,68 @@ +{ + "name": "ggml", + "version": "0.9.4", + "port-version": 1, + "description": "Tensor library for machine learning", + "homepage": "https://github.com/ggml-org/ggml", + "license": "MIT", + "supports": "!uwp", + "dependencies": [ + { + "name": "vcpkg-cmake", + "host": true + }, + { + "name": "vcpkg-cmake-config", + "host": true + } + ], + "features": { + "blas": { + "description": "Enable BLAS support", + "dependencies": [ + "blas", + "cblas" + ] + }, + "cuda": { + "description": "Enable CUDA support", + "supports": "!(windows & staticcrt)", + "dependencies": [ + "cuda" + ] + }, + "metal": { + "description": "Enable Metal support", + "supports": "osx" + }, + "opencl": { + "description": "Enable OpenCL support", + "supports": "!arm32", + "dependencies": [ + "opencl" + ] + }, + "openmp": { + "description": "Enable OpenMP support", + "supports": "!osx" + }, + "vulkan": { + "description": "Enable Vulkan support", + "dependencies": [ + { + "name": "ggml", + "host": true, + "default-features": false, + "features": [ + "vulkan" + ] + }, + { + "name": "shaderc", + "host": true + }, + "vulkan" + ] + } + } +} |